[laughter] all right. let's. consumer news. we have a recall to pass along to parents tonight. especially parents with children. and parents with car seats. even-flow is recalling the 3-in-1 seat. the central front adjuster button used to loose on the seat's harness is the concern. it may be within the child's reach allowing the child to loosen the harness. this covers the booster seats 3 in 1 made from december 18th through january 29th 2016. no injuries have been reported. is this season's flu vaccine effective?
